Hello Jeroen, I have worked in the past days on improvements of ptloader for multi domain setup, building on your work described in [1]. We have had the additional requirement that we want users to be able to login with just their UID. If I understand right, this was not possible with the current ptloader yet? My approach is, if there is no domain component in the canon_id, to go through all domains listed in domain_base_dn (usually cn=kolab,cn=config). Then search for the canon_id in each domain. If we get an unique match, we use that domain as the base. On the other hand, perhaps I should stop at the first occurance, to speed up things. I have another patch [4] that makes sure that no duplicate UIDs are created across domains. If you would have time and fun to have a look at this patch for Cyrus ptloader [2], that would be highly appreciated. My knowledge of C is quite rusty. It works in my initial tests, but I don't have it in production yet. By the way, I wonder if there is a side-effect in [3]? It sets the ptsm->base although that is not really needed, but that has effects on future requests, because the base is now set instead of dc=%1,dc=%2. Perhaps that just confused me when testing things, and is no real issue at all?
